TESTS ON EMBEDDED STEEL BILLETS FOR PRECAST CONCRETE BEAM-COLUMN CONNECTIONS
Sixty specimens were tested, each consisting of a short length of column with a single steel billet cast into it. The variables involved were the size of the billet, the reinforcement details and the column load. The results are compared with current design methods based solely on concrete bearing capacity. An improved design method is proposed which makes allowance for the reinforcement.(a) /TRRL/
